AI Context Engineering: Business Loyalty Strategies

Global business analysts reported AI-driven context engineering's role in customer retention on 2026-02-03 in market analysis reports to detail its application in enhancing customer service through personalization and context awareness, fostering loyalty across sectors. Enterprises face ongoing challenges in customer acquisition and retention, making AI an instrumental tool for improving engagement and mitigating churn.

Key Details and Analysis

The implementation of context engineering frameworks leverages AI to provide real-time, adaptive user experiences by interpreting situational data. This capability extends beyond basic automation, enabling systems to anticipate customer needs and preferences. Firms deploying these systems report shifts in customer interaction paradigms, moving from reactive problem resolution to proactive support. This strategic pivot impacts operational efficiency and customer lifetime value.

Structural Differentiation (Market Moat)

Context engineering distinguishes itself from broader AI applications in customer service through its intent and operational model. Its intent is to establish real-time, adaptive user experiences via deep situational understanding, predicting individual needs before explicit queries arise. This contrasts with general AI in customer service, which primarily automates routine tasks, manages basic queries, and provides rule-based recommendations without the same level of anticipatory capability. The model for context engineering requires integrated data platforms, advanced machine learning for behavioral analytics, and continuous feedback loops, demanding significant data governance and integration investment. Conversely, broader AI in CX is often implemented through more standardized chatbot solutions, basic CRM integrations, and pre-configured analytics modules.

Why This Matters

The adoption of AI-driven context engineering aligns with two significant market shifts. One specific industry trend is the transition from transactional customer support to hyper-personalization and proactive customer engagement. This change is driven by consumer expectations for individualized brand interactions, demanding that brands anticipate needs rather than solely react to problems. A key macro-economic driver is intensifying global competition, which elevates customer retention to a primary growth driver. Investment in AI aims to optimize customer lifetime value and reduce acquisition costs, providing a competitive advantage in a consolidating market landscape where customer loyalty directly impacts revenue stability and expansion.
